Output 68a209b75b38dfd9d212b259eb04296fa2851c6313fd111131cb1220e8a48561:2

value
58583435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9354798b6105c77e0ce0ba70fbd79537364b1073 OP_EQUAL
address
MMLAm3H5rTJVQdxJ4TyHxmNJh5iYQcuLhU
transaction
68a209b75b38dfd9d212b259eb04296fa2851c6313fd111131cb1220e8a48561
spent
true